Bird Strike Grounds IndiGo Flight: Passengers Delayed
A bird strike caused the cancellation of an IndiGo flight bound for Bengaluru from Thiruvananthapuram, affecting 179 passengers. The aircraft returned to its bay for maintenance, and passengers were rebooked on another flight scheduled for 6:30 pm.

A scheduled flight from Thiruvananthapuram to Bengaluru faced an unexpected halt due to a bird strike on Monday morning, airport authorities reported.
The incident occurred moments before takeoff, impacting 179 passengers aboard IndiGo flight 6E 6629. Officials confirmed that the aircraft had to return to its bay for safety checks and maintenance.
Airport sources indicated that the affected passengers were accommodated on an alternate flight later in the day at 6:30 pm as the impacted aircraft underwent necessary repairs.
